Nitration: a disruption for solvent extraction operations

In solvent extraction, nitration is a complex phenomenon that plagues circuits. Nitration is a chemical reaction that occurs when nitronium ions (NO₂⁺) are present in SX feeds. These ions react with extractants, preventing the stripping and removal of copper ions from the electrolyte solution.

Nitration leads to many challenges, including the loss of copper transfer capacity, increased phase disengagement times, reduced interfacial tension and increased phase entrainment. Nitration even leads to higher extractant consumption and accelerated hydrolytic degradation.
